Edward Moore Kennedy Jr., often known as Ted Kennedy Jr., is a distinguished American lawyer and politician. As the son of Senator Edward "Ted" Kennedy Sr. and the nephew of President John F. Kennedy and Senator Robert F. Kennedy, Edward Jr. has upheld the Kennedy legacy of public service and advocacy. Childhood and Family Background
Edward Jr. was born on September 26, 1961, in Boston, Massachusetts. He is the son of Senator Ted Kennedy and Joan Bennett Kennedy. Growing up, he was part of one of America's most prominent political families, with uncles John F. Kennedy and Robert F. Kennedy being key figures in American history.
Overcoming Health Challenges
At the age of 12, Edward Jr. faced a life-altering health challenge. In November 1973, he was diagnosed with osteosarcoma, a type of bone cancer, which led to the amputation of his right leg. Despite this setback, he demonstrated remarkable resilience and became an advocate for people with disabilities.

Legal Career
Edward Jr. pursued a career in law, following his family's strong legal tradition. He earned his undergraduate degree from Wesleyan University and subsequently attended the University of Connecticut School of Law. Later, he obtained a master's degree in environmental law from Yale University.
Epstein Becker & Green
Edward Kennedy Jr. is a partner at Epstein Becker & Green, a prestigious law firm known for its expertise in healthcare and life sciences, labor and employment, and litigation. At the firm, he has focused on healthcare policy and disability rights, leveraging his personal experiences to advocate for inclusive policies.
Political Career
Edward Jr.'s political career is marked by his tenure as a member of the Connecticut State Senate, where he represented the 12th district from 2015 to 2019.
Connecticut State Senate
In April 2014, Edward Kennedy Jr. announced his candidacy for the Connecticut State Senate. He won the election on November 4, 2014, and was re-elected on November 8, 2016. During his time in office, he focused on healthcare reform, environmental protection, and disability rights.

Family and Relationships
Edward Jr. is married to Katherine Anne Gershman, a Yale-trained doctor and healthcare executive. Together, they have two children: Kiley Elizabeth Kennedy and Edward Moore Kennedy III. The family resides in Branford, Connecticut, where they actively participate in community activities.

Disability Advocacy
Edward Jr. has been a staunch advocate for the rights of people with disabilities. He served as the Chairman of the American Association of People with Disabilities, where he worked tirelessly to promote policies that ensure equal opportunities for all.
